Nada Strom 1899 - 1981

Nada Strom of Seaford, Sussex County, Delaware was born on February 6, 1899, and died at age 82 years old in December 1981.

In 1899, in the year that Nada Strom was born, on February 14th, the first voting machines were approved by Congress for use in federal elections. Several states were already using voting machines in their elections and the Federal government was finally convinced of their safety and accuracy.

In 1927, she was 28 years old when in September, the Columbia Broadcasting System (later called CBS) became the second national radio network in the U.S. The first broadcast was a presentation by the Howard Barlow Orchestra from radio station WOR in Newark, New Jersey.
